Actionable SEO Strategies for 2026

Optimize for Search Intent

One of the most significant trends in SEO 2026 is aligning content with search intent. Understanding whether users are looking for information, services, products, or comparisons allows businesses to craft content that satisfies their queries. AI-driven tools help predict user intent, ensuring content is relevant, contextually accurate, and positioned for high engagement.

Embrace Voice and Visual Search

With the proliferation of smart devices, voice search optimization is essential. Content should adopt natural, conversational language, often in the form of questions and answers. Visual search also matters, particularly for e-commerce and service-oriented businesses. Images should be high-quality, properly tagged, and structured to enhance discoverability in both Google Search and AI-powered search engines.

Content Diversification and AI Assistance

Businesses should produce a mix of long-form articles, infographics, videos, and interactive content. Tools like SEMrush and Ahrefs can help identify trending topics and keyword opportunities. While AI can assist in content generation, businesses must maintain human oversight to ensure depth, originality, and expertise—factors critical for SEO future explained and ranking success.

Focus on User Experience

Core Web Vitals, page speed, and mobile-first design are central to modern SEO. Google’s algorithm increasingly favors sites that deliver smooth user experiences. By improving UX, businesses can reduce bounce rates, increase dwell time, and enhance engagement—factors that directly impact search rankings and organic traffic.
